Get PriceNow, modern lithium-ion batteries, like those used in Teslas, laptops, and phones, are the most popular choice for EV makers the world over, and they still rely on nickel as a main component. In fact, batteries based on nickel cobalt aluminum chemistry — like those Tesla use — can be up to 80% nickel, according to the Nickel Institute.

Get PriceMar 11, 2021 · They are one of the largest global nickel producers. Their nickel mining operations produce cobalt as a by-product. Their cobalt is mainly produced in a mine in the Cuban town of Moa. However, it is processed at a refinery in Saskatchewan, Canada. This is to minimize the political challenges that come with operating in Cuba.

Get PriceOct 12, 2021 · Recently two nickel mining companies in Indonesia announced plans to use deep-sea disposal for the raw material waste into the Coral Triangle as they ramp up operations. Less than 20 nickel mines worldwide use deep-sea disposal, but these new facilities would account for millions of tons of waste material each year.

Get PriceOct 22, 2021 · Laterite deposits are typically mined by open cut or strip mining. The USGS 2021 Nickel Commodity Summary cites only one active nickel mine in the United States—the underground Eagle Mine in Michigan. The new chalcopyrite-pentlandite mine was commissioned in April 2021 and is the first nickel-producing mine in the country in 18 years.
